Далее, выявлены недостатки протокола Proof-of-Work (доказательство работы): высокая затратность, недостаточная энергоемкость в блоке, сохранение возможности двойной траты монет. Для их преодоления наметился переход к протоколу POS. Новое состоит в том, что в сети случайным порядком выбирается майнер, который подтверждает правильность транзакций. Но ему приходится вносить залог («заморозка» ресурса) для страховки своей честности (доверяй, но страховка не мешает). Одновременно наметился переход на DPOS – консенсус, когда майнеры выбираются не сетью, а пользователями при сохранении правила заморозки ресурса.
Совершенствование блокчейна происходит постоянно и связано с необходимостью изменения правил работы сети. Если изменения несущественные, то этот процесс называют софтфорком, а если серьезные, то – хардфорком (в переводе – жесткая развилка), что ставит перед пользователем выбор, по какому варианту следовать дальше – по старому или по новому. Во втором случае чаще всего происходит создание новой криптовалюты, что сопровождается ее майнингом и выходом на рынок. Эмитент может под этот новый проект организовать ICO и выпустить для продажи токены. Иными словами, периодические изменения правил работы сети делают блокчейн гибкой системой, готовой к приспособлению к новой ситуации на финансовых и информационных рынках.
Поиски вариантов совершенствования различны, Например, эксперты выделялют четыре проекта совершенствования технологии блокчейна для криптовалюты. Первый – проект Lightning Network, который появился еще в 2015 году. По сути – это децентрализованная система каналов для микроплатежей. когда в блокчейн записывается не каждая отдельная операция, а сразу баланс канала, что значительно снижает нагрузку на блокчейн биткоина. Второй – это проект IOST, когда разработчики решили использовать уникальную систему шардинга. Шардинг – это разделение базы данных на множество более мелких, и, соответственно, легче управляемых баз, называемых шардами (shard – черепок, осколок). Для этого в IOST используют собственный метод шардинга – «эффективным распределенным шардингом». Такой подход уменьшает нагрузку на обработку транзакций на отдельном узле, а также увеличивает общую пропускную способность. Третий – это проект в команде Enigma под названием «секретные контракты». Они очень похожи на обычные смарт-контракты, но с таким отличием: данные, проходящие через секретные контракты в Enigma, обрабатываются узлами, но узлы их «не видят». Это достигается путем разделения смарт-контракта на части, которые затем зашифровываются по-отдельности, а после обработки объединяются обратно. Этот процесс называется «безопасной раздельной обработкой». Четвертый – это проект Ark по организации совместимости между разными блокчейнами. Новые блокчейны построены на различной архитектуре, и они не могут общаться между собой. Сейчас единственный способ перевести активы из одного блокчейна в другой – это централизованный обменник. Для достижения совместимости в Arc разработали собственную технологию под названием SmartBridge («умный мост»), что SmartBridge позволяет блокчейнам связываться и обмениваться данными друг с другом – для интеграции необходимо добавить в блокчейн-проект небольшой фрагмент кода.
Конец ознакомительного фрагмента.
Текст предоставлен ООО «ЛитРес».
Прочитайте эту книгу целиком, на ЛитРес.
Безопасно оплатить книгу можно банковской картой Visa, MasterCard, Maestro, со счета мобильного телефона, с платежного терминала, в салоне МТС или Связной, через PayPal, WebMoney, Яндекс.Деньги, QIWI Кошелек, бонусными картами или другим удобным Вам способом.